Towards a Visual Theatre -- Presentation and Discussion.
Thursday, Jan 24, 1-2:30PM
Aaron Kelstone (National Technical Institute for the Deaf -- Handamation)
The journey to create a visual theatre does not exclusively belong to
deaf people or any other special group. Living on the fringe of the
arts creates a rarified place that a wide variety of artists, hearing
and deaf, have gone to visit. Part of the artistic motivation to
explore essentially connects to the human need to express visually,
across language and cultural boundaries, the issues and concerns that
need to be conveyed without the hindrance of text. Deaf Theatre
developed from a natural tendency for deaf people to seek a visual
means of expression. Visual theatre is motivated by other potential
areas of need. Can the two art forms working together provide new
